Chelsea players ‘may have misheard Clattenburg’s Geordie accent’

Chelsea players who reported Mark Clattenburg’s alleged racial remarks during Sunday’s game against Manchester United may have misheard his Geordie accent, the Daily Mirror suggest.

Brazilians Ramires and David Luiz are said to have alleged that the match official told John Obi Mikel: “Shut up, monkey”.

But it is claimed Chelsea officials and players questioned whether they were confused by his accent and he actually said: “Shut up, Mikel”.

It is also claimed that club insiders admit their case is further confused because Ramires speaks very limited English.

A source is quoted as saying: “The players stand by what they heard but there is a growing concern that a genuine mistake has been made because of the language barrier.”

Clattenburg denies any wrongdoing and has said he will cooperate with an FA investigation.
